Kelley Farm

Location: Bonney Lake

Owner/developer: Kelley Farm

Project team: Canyon Creek LLC, general contractor; Smith Art Concrete, concrete contractor; Corliss Resources, ready-mix supplier




Kelley Farm, established in 1864, is the oldest farm in Bonney Lake. It is now a venue for large gatherings such as weddings and corporate meetings.

The barn, which serves as the events hall, was recently renovated. Work included pouring a new foundation and piers to provide adequate support for the structure.

A new interior slab with radiant floor heating was ground, color-stained and polished. Outdoor courtyards are a combination of integrally colored pea gravel, exposed brick and boardwalk plank-stamped concrete.

Countertops in the kitchen and baths are poured-in-place colored concrete that have been ground, polished and sealed.
